Social network you want to login/join with:
Senior Associate Landscape Architect, London
col-narrow-left
Client:
AE Recruitment
Location:
London, United Kingdom
Job Category:
Other
-
EU work permit required:
Yes
col-narrow-right
Job Reference:
6c27056068bf
Job Views:
11
Posted:
22.06.2025
Expiry Date:
06.08.2025
col-wide
Job Description:
Job Description
A prestigious, design-led Landscape Architecture practice, renowned for its collaboration with global visionaries like BIG, KPF, and Foster + Partners, is seeking a Senior Associate to join their growing London studio.
With an established presence across Europe and the Middle East, this firm is celebrated for delivering ambitious, high-profile projects across hospitality, mixed-use, and public realm sectors. Their work is bold, highly conceptual, and rooted in a strong design philosophy. This is an opportunity to step into a leadership role with an exceptional studio shaping the future of contemporary landscapes on an international scale.
You’ll take the reins on multiple large-scale design projects, overseeing creative direction and project execution from concept through to post-contract stages. Reporting directly to the Managing Partner and Design Principal, you’ll serve as a trusted advisor to both the internal team and external clients, representing the studio’s design integrity at every step.
Key Responsibilities- Lead several complex landscape projects in parallel across varied global locations
- Inspire and mentor a talented team of designers and technical staff
- Represent the studio in client meetings and high-level presentations
- Guide project design development through to delivery, including post-contract stages
- Contribute to strategic studio growth and design culture
Requirements
- A minimum of 12 years' experience in Landscape Architecture, with a strong design portfolio from top-tier practices
- Bachelor’s or Master’s degree in Landscape Architecture (Honours)
- Must be proficient with AutoCAD, Adobe and understand Revit.
- Proven ability to manage large-scale resort, hotel, public realm, and mixed-use projects
- Highly creative, organized, and collaborative, with natural leadership presence
- Strong client-facing skills and the confidence to lead with clarity and vision
- Ideally, exposure to projects in the Gulf region
- Native-level fluency in English (spoken and written)
Benefits
This is more than just a career move—it’s a chance to leave a lasting mark on some of the world’s most exciting landscapes. You'll be part of a collaborative, visionary team working at the forefront of global design, with the support and infrastructure of a firm that truly values creativity and leadership.
While this role is based in London, they have offices in Europe and Dubai so you'll have flexibility in where you can work from.
RequirementsA minimum of 12 years' experience in Landscape Architecture, with a strong design portfolio from top-tier practices Bachelor’s or Master’s degree in Landscape Architecture (Honours) Must be proficient with AutoCAD, Adobe and understand Revit. Proven ability to manage large-scale resort, hotel, public realm, and mixed-use projects Highly creative, organized, and collaborative, with natural leadership presence Strong client-facing skills and the confidence to lead with clarity and vision Ideally, exposure to projects in the Gulf region Native-level fluency in English (spoken and written)